Essential Components And Technologies for Mastering SAP PI Training
- SAP PI Design Studio:
SAP PI Design Studio is an essential tool for developing integration scenarios within the SAP PI platform. It provides an intuitive graphical interface that enables professionals to create configure and deploy integration flows efficiently. The tool helps in visualizing and implementing message mappings communication channels and integration scenarios. Professionals use it to design complex data transformations and monitor their execution. SAP PI Design Studio simplifies the development process allowing for faster implementation of integration solutions and ensuring that data flows seamlessly between systems.
- Enterprise Service Repository (ESR):
The ESR is a key component of SAP PI used to define and manage business objects data structures and service interfaces. It serves as the central repository for all metadata in the integration landscape. Professionals use ESR to model and design interfaces message types and mappings that are critical for SAP PI integration scenarios as it enables the creation of reusable components that can be leveraged across multiple integration projects making the development process more efficient and standardized.
- Integration Directory (ID):
The Integration Directory (ID) is where integration scenarios are configured and maintained after they are designed in ESR. This tool enables the configuration of communication channels sender/receiver agreements and routing rules. SAP PI professionals use the ID to map business systems to communication channels define message routing logic and configure security settings as it is a vital tool for ensuring smooth flow of messages between different systems in the landscape ensuring that SAP PI operates seamlessly.
- Adapter Framework:
The Adapter Framework in SAP PI is responsible for handling communication between SAP PI and external systems. It supports multiple adapters for different protocols such as HTTP JMS FTP and SAP-specific adapters like IDoc and RFC. Professionals working with SAP PI use the Adapter Framework to configure and manage communication channels for integrating various third-party systems as the tool enables seamless communication between heterogeneous systems by providing standardized adapters for different protocols enhancing flexibility and scalability in integration projects.
- Message Mapping Tool:
Message mapping is crucial for transforming data between source and target formats in SAP PI. The Message Mapping Tool is used to define how the data will be transformed during the integration process. SAP PI professionals utilize this tool to create mappings that convert data structures ensuring compatibility between different systems as the graphical user interface allows users to design complex transformations with ease making it a powerful tool for data integration. The tool also supports Java and XSLT mapping for more advanced transformation needs.
- Runtime Workbench:
The Runtime Workbench is an essential tool for monitoring and managing SAP PI systems. It provides a comprehensive view of the system’s status message processing and performance metrics. Professionals use this tool to track messages view logs troubleshoot errors and analyze system performance. The Runtime Workbench is key to ensuring smooth operation in real-time helping users quickly identify and resolve issues that may arise in the integration landscape as its intuitive interface and real time monitoring capabilities make it indispensable for managing SAP PI effectively.
- Advanced Adapter Engine (AAE):
The Advanced Adapter Engine (AAE) in SAP PI is a streamlined version of the Adapter Engine that processes messages without requiring the full SAP PI infrastructure. It is particularly useful for scenarios where only message processing is needed making it a lightweight alternative for simpler integrations. AAE is designed for high-throughput environments where low latency and faster processing are required. Professionals use AAE to manage simpler faster integrations with reduced system complexity providing high availability and efficient message routing.
- System Landscape Directory (SLD):
The System Landscape Directory (SLD) is a central repository that holds information about all the systems in the SAP landscape including SAP and non-SAP systems. SAP PI uses the SLD to maintain information about the system components such as software versions host names and system roles. This tool is essential for configuring communication between systems as it provides the necessary metadata for SAP PI to process integration scenarios. SLD enables efficient system management by ensuring accurate and up to date information is available for integration purposes.
